Output 31f8270d2f5806584b13fb50bc2ef4c61431af740085fff342d7cf7e3a472325:5

value
1950000
script pubkey
OP_0 OP_PUSHBYTES_20 abfabaaa6c1909c7cc3e2a7db9bc42347fece607
address
bc1q40at42nvryyu0np79f7mn0zzx3l7ees8jksn8r
transaction
31f8270d2f5806584b13fb50bc2ef4c61431af740085fff342d7cf7e3a472325
spent
true